She was born in Chicago in May 17, 1966 and is best known for her role as Cheri Fontenot in With Or Without You alongside Guy Torry. She has also appeared in films such as Mo' Better Blues, Love Jones, and How to Be a Player.

About

Actress who portrayed the role of Cheri Fontenot in With Or Without You alongside Guy Torry.

Before Fame

She attended Ball State University in Indiana.

Trivia

She recorded the single Harlem Blues which reached number nine on the R&B charts in 1990.

Family Life

She has been married three times; her last marriage was to Roderick Plummer in 2001.

Associated With

She appeared in the film Turning Point with Ernie Hudson.
